The IRF9395MTR1PBF belongs to the category of power MOSFETs.
It is commonly used in power management applications such as voltage regulation and switching circuits.
The IRF9395MTR1PBF is typically available in a TO-252 package.
This MOSFET is essential for efficient power control and management in various electronic devices and systems.
It is usually supplied in reels with a specific quantity per reel, typically 250 or 500 pieces.
The IRF9395MTR1PBF typically has three pins: 1. Gate (G) 2. Drain (D) 3. Source (S)
The IRF9395MTR1PBF operates based on the principles of field-effect transistors, utilizing the control of electric fields to modulate the conductivity of the semiconductor material.
The IRF9395MTR1PBF is widely used in: - Switching power supplies - DC-DC converters - Motor control circuits - Battery management systems
